The Vice President of Marketing is a front-and-center leadership role reporting directly to the CEO, with regular communication to board members. This position is responsible for shaping the Starbird brand experience and accelerating our expansion in the fast-casual space. The Opportunity The Vice President of Marketing is a key member of Starbird’s executive leadership team and a strategic partner to the CEO and cross-functional leaders. This role owns the end-to-end marketing strategy across corporate restaurants and the expanding franchise system — driving brand awareness, guest acquisition, digital engagement, loyalty, and revenue growth. This leader will bring deep experience scaling restaurant or food & beverage brands, building high-performance teams, and creating repeatable, franchise-ready marketing systems. The ideal candidate is both a visionary brand builder and a highly operational, data-driven executive who thrives in fast-growth, entrepreneurial environments. Requirements

  • BS, MBA preferred
  • 15+ years of proven executive-level marketing leadership in restaurant, food & beverage, or multi-unit consumer brands
  • Experience scaling brands in fast-growth environments, including franchise systems
  • Strong background in brand strategy, performance marketing, loyalty, and digital platforms
  • Proven track record operating both strategically, setting vision, and tactically executing an operational road map
  • Data-driven decision maker with a strong creative sensibility
  • Exceptional people leader who builds high-performing teams and culture
  • Strategic notice paired with hands-on operational execution

Responsibilities

  • Lead Starbird’s brand vision, positioning, and storytelling to support national expansion
  • Build long-term brand equity while driving near-term performance growth
  • Develop and execute the annual marketing strategy, goals, and operating plan
  • Present marketing strategy, performance, budgets, and growth initiatives to the Board
  • Lead, develop, and inspire a high-performing marketing and sales team
  • Establish strong operating rhythms, decision-making processes, and cross-functional alignment
  • Own guest acquisition, retention, loyalty, and digital engagement strategies
  • Drive performance marketing across digital and in-restaurant channels to increase traffic, frequency, and average check
  • Lead promotional strategy, creative development, and execution aligned with brand and culinary vision
  • Oversee catering marketing strategy to drive incremental revenue and brand elevation
  • Optimize ROI across promotions and campaigns
  • Own Starbird’s brand voice and messaging across internal and external communications
  • Lead PR strategy and agency partnerships aligned with growth and brand priorities
  • Ensure integrated communications across brand campaigns, menu launches, and market expansions
  • Own brand standards, visual identity, and style guides
  • Ensure creative consistency across all touchpoints — digital, in-store, menu, third-party platforms, and franchise materials
  • Manage creative agencies, RFPs, and vendor partnerships
  • Lead brand refinements and evolutions to support growth while preserving Starbird’s culture and roots
  • Provide strategic oversight of loyalty and digital platform migrations and performance
  • Ensure seamless guest communication, campaign execution, and data integrity during system transitions
  • Build a franchise-ready marketing infrastructure and playbook
  • Partner with franchise leadership to support new market launches and local marketing execution
  • Develop tools, training, and systems that enable franchisees to drive results while maintaining brand standards
